chief provincial inspector: public transport unit (ptu - waterberg district), Ref No. LDTCS W5/2026
Apply for chief provincial inspector: public transport unit (ptu - waterberg district) at department of limpopo department of transport and community safety. Closing date 2026-03-13.
Minimum Qualification
Undergraduate qualification NQF level 6 or equivalent plus a recognised Traffic Diploma
Experience Required
7-10 years total, 3-5 years at Supervisory level in Traffic Law Enforcement and Public Transport Regulation
Required Competencies & Skills
- Extensive knowledge of National Land Transport Act and Criminal Procedure Act
- Expertise in accident reconstruction and traffic law enforcement
- Strategic leadership and project management skills
- Advanced report writing and communication abilities
- Proficiency in change management and service delivery innovation
Requirements
- 3 - 5 years' experience at Principal Provincial Inspector level
- 7-10 years working experience in the traffic law enforcement field
Key Responsibilities & Duties
- Manage the strategic and operational implementation of the Public Transport Unit (PTU) within the district
- Direct and supervise 'stop and check' operations to ensure public transport compliance
- Oversee the management, maintenance, and safeguarding of the unit's assets and specialized equipment
- Administer office operations including personnel management and statutory reporting
